Richard Sutcliffe was an Irish mining engineer and inventor, active in England. He was born on a farm in County Tipperary and worked at coal mines in Ireland between 1857 and 1885. He moved to Barnsley, England in August 1885. In 1892 he invented the world's first coal cutting machine. In 1905 he invented the world's first underground conveyor belt.
